CM Siddaramaiah to Inaugurate Women of Worth 2025 in town

Bengaluru Express

Bengaluru, May 31: 

Chief Minister Siddaramaiah will inaugurate the fifth edition of the Women of Worth (WOW) 2025 programme on June 4 at the Vivanta Taj Hotel in Yeshwanthpur. The invitation to the Chief Minister was personally extended by Mrs. K. Ratna Prabha, President of Ubuntu Women’s Network and former Chief Secretary of Karnataka, along with other founders of the Ubuntu platform, which has been at the forefront of recognizing and empowering women entrepreneurs across India.

Addressing the media after extending the invitation, Ratna Prabha confirmed that Union Minister of State for Micro, Small and Medium Enterprises and Labour and Employment, Shobha Karandlaje, will inaugurate the exhibition segment of the event, while Karnataka’s Minister for Small Scale Industries and Public Sector Enterprises, Sharnabasappa Darshanapur, will serve as the Guest of Honour.

First launched in 2015–16 with the inaugural edition also graced by Chief Minister Siddaramaiah, the WOW Awards aim to celebrate and encourage women entrepreneurs, particularly from smaller towns, by recognizing their contributions and achievements. Over the years, the initiative has evolved into a major national platform, with this year’s edition expecting the participation of 100 exhibitors and 300 delegates.

Ubuntu, the organizing body, has grown into a formidable network, currently comprising 57 associations across 12 states. Through its various initiatives, it supports over 30,000 women entrepreneurs nationwide. Entrepreneurs from across the country—including states like Goa, Maharashtra, Madhya Pradesh, and Assam—are expected to participate in the 2025 edition.

In addition to recognition and networking, the WOW event includes practical training sessions for women entrepreneurs. These cover essential topics such as cybercrime awareness and e-commerce skills development to help participants safeguard their businesses and expand their market reach.

With strong backing from both state and union ministers, the WOW 2025 programme continues to underscore the growing commitment to empowering women-led enterprises and nurturing inclusive economic growth in the country.
